Key topics
— Bitcoin broke above $100k with short-term holder cost basis at ~93k acting as psychological resistance; clearing this supply zone suggests bulls in control.
— Gold's 10-year bull market is reshaping global reserve asset allocation, and Bitcoin is likely to follow as a competing sound-money asset; this is the first time both have moved simultaneously at scale.
— On-chain data shows ETFs driving ~20–25% of demand, MicroStrategy and Sailor continuing to buy, and retail wallet balances flat since 2023; most buying is institutional or corporate.
— Bitcoin cycles may be ossifying: near-term topping cloud signals around 150–160k (5% statistical extreme), but longer correction cycles similar to gold (40–50% pullbacks over months/years) are more likely than 80% bear markets.
— The OP_RETURN debate centers on mempool policy filters to reduce data spam, but filters risk creating direct miner pipelines that embed the problem rather than solve it; consensus code is not at stake.
— MicroStrategy's Saylor premium (market cap ÷ Bitcoin holdings) hit 2x, historically where most capital-raising occurs; new levered financial products (MSTY, MSTX, MSTU) package volatility to Wall Street but carry tail risks.
Market & price signals
— Bitcoin at $100k+ with weekly close potentially at all-time high; S&P 500 down meaningfully from ATH while Bitcoin near peak signals decoupling during equity market stress.
— Bitcoin up 80% YTD 2024, gold up 40%, S&P 500 up only ~3%—on-chain performance dominated by hard assets.
— Realized cap increasing ~$20 billion/month; ETF inflows ~$5 billion/month with recurring outflow/inflow cycles (300–400M weekly outflows followed by 1.5–2B inflows) suggest sustained institutional demand.
— True market mean (active investor cost basis) currently ~68k; used as bear-market floor model, not expected to be breached unless deleveraging event or "omega candle" occurs.
— MicroStrategy market cap at all-time high ($113B) with price dilution; Saylor premium at 2x, triggering historical capital-raise cycle; $55k BTC purchased near $100k.
